Glenmorangie Signet, arguably the most unique whisky in the core range, debuted in 2008.

It is a blend of whisky distilled from local barley, aged for up to 30 years, and whisky distilled from chocolate malt (approx. 20%), aged for approximately 10 years. Chocolate malt is used in the production of dark beers such as porters and stout. The whisky's name refers to a design carved into stone by the Picts who ruled northern Scotland in the 9th century, which adorns almost every Glenmorangie bottle. Glenmorangie Signet has won several significant medals and awards, most recently a gold medal in 2017 at the International Spirit Challenge.

Nose: Rich, dark chocolate, coffee beans, raisins, hazelnuts, prunes, bitter orange jam, golden syrup, toasted sesame seeds, and hints of tobacco and oak.

Palate: Rich and elegant, chocolate truffles, espresso, orange zest, honey-roasted almonds, dried dates and plums, caramel, cinnamon, hints of vanilla and tobacco.

Finish: Long, with notes of dark chocolate, dried berries, bitter oranges, tobacco, and oak.
